package de.knurt.heinzelmann.util.urlcontent;

import java.io.IOException;

import javax.xml.ws.http.HTTPException;

import org.apache.commons.httpclient.HttpClient;
import org.apache.commons.httpclient.contrib.ssl.EasySSLProtocolSocketFactory;
import org.apache.commons.httpclient.methods.GetMethod;
import org.apache.commons.httpclient.protocol.Protocol;

/**
 * work with content of an unsecured ssl connection. do not use if it can be a
 * safty leg!
 * 
 * @link 
 *       http://svn.apache.org/viewvc/httpcomponents/oac.hc3x/trunk/src/contrib/org
 *       /apache/commons/httpclient/contrib/ssl/EasySSLProtocolSocketFactory.
 *       java?view=markup
 * @author Daniel Oltmanns
 * @since 0.20100728
 * @version 0.20100728
 */
public class HttpsUnsecuredContent implements URLContent {

    @SuppressWarnings("deprecation")
    @Override
    public String getContent(String urlstring) throws IOException, HTTPException {
        Protocol easyhttps = new Protocol("https", new EasySSLProtocolSocketFactory(), 443);
        Protocol.registerProtocol("https", easyhttps);

        HttpClient client = new HttpClient();
        GetMethod httpget = new GetMethod(urlstring);
        client.executeMethod(httpget);
        return httpget.getResponseBodyAsString();
    }

    /** one and only instance of me */
    private volatile static HttpsUnsecuredContent me;

    /** construct me */
    private HttpsUnsecuredContent() {
    }

    /**
     * return the one and only instance of HttpsUnsecuredContent
     * 
     * @return the one and only instance of HttpsUnsecuredContent
     */
    public static HttpsUnsecuredContent getInstance() {
        if (me == null) { // no instance so far
            synchronized (HttpsUnsecuredContent.class) {
                if (me == null) { // still no instance so far
                    me = new HttpsUnsecuredContent(); // the one and only
                }
            }
        }
        return me;
    }
}
